Pros

- Flexible timings - Kochi, Trivandrum offices offer a better work environment than Chennai office

Cons

- Not valuing every employee equally: When you are waiting in pool to get allocated to a project, chances are you might not get a computer system to work on and are not given any direction by the management as to what the next step for the resource should be. - Training wasn't complete: I belonged to the 'fast-track' batch when I was under training after joining the organization. And before even having the working knowledge of the skills taught by the trainers, I was put into a project with little knowledge as to how to go about doing my daily tasks. As the days went by, coming to office started feeling like a nightmare.
